Vue 相信大多數(shù)人都了解,bootstrap 與 Vue 一樣是前端框架,但他們有各自不同的優(yōu)點,一起來看看吧。
Bootstrap
bootstrap 屬于前端頁面框架,作用是快速開發(fā)響應(yīng)式頁面
它的特點是柵格式系統(tǒng),使用較為簡單方便,上手也是容易,專門用于響應(yīng)式頁面,它的代碼可以在平板電腦與PC中自適應(yīng),大大減少了代碼冗長復(fù)雜的缺點,讓程序員高效編程提高用戶體驗性。
缺點是缺少成體系的相關(guān)組件,在使用時會發(fā)生作用域沖突的問題,如果沒整理一整套組件,會很麻煩。
Vue
Vue 屬于前端 JS 庫,它將前端開發(fā)進(jìn)行組件化,它在 React 基礎(chǔ)上優(yōu)化后更為出色。
1、簡單易學(xué)
Vue屬于國人開發(fā),有我們自己的中文文檔,不存在語言不通,更方便我們的理解和學(xué)習(xí)
2、輕量級的框架
關(guān)注其視圖層是一個構(gòu)建數(shù)據(jù)的集合視圖,它的大小就幾十 KB。Vue 采用簡潔的 API 提供了高效數(shù)據(jù)綁定與靈活組件系統(tǒng)。
3、雙向數(shù)據(jù)綁定
Vue 保留 angular 的部分特點,讓我們在數(shù)據(jù)操作方面更容易。
4、組件化
Vue 同樣保留了 React 優(yōu)點,使用 HTMl 的封裝和重用,構(gòu)建單頁面應(yīng)用有著獨特優(yōu)勢
5、運(yùn)行速度更快
與 React 比較而言,同樣都為操作虛擬 DOM,按性能來看 Vue 有這更大優(yōu)勢
6、視圖,數(shù)據(jù),結(jié)構(gòu)分離
Vue 實現(xiàn)數(shù)據(jù)的更改更簡單,不再需要邏輯代碼的修改,我們只要操作數(shù)據(jù)就可以進(jìn)行相關(guān)操作。
以上就是小編為您整理的關(guān)于 bootstrap 和 vue 哪個好的全部內(nèi)容,想要學(xué)習(xí)更多請點擊:Vue1.0教程、Bootstrap教程